BlackBerry, Gaiman Announce New Project
Written by Ella Thomson on Monday, February 11th, 2013BlackBerry has announced that it will be collaborating with author Neil Gaiman on a year-long project. The project is called A Calendar of Tales and installments will be released on a monthly basis. One interesting little twist is that readers will be encouraged to contribute.
“I’ve always been fascinated by the relationship between fans and artists, and between art and technology,” said Gaiman. “This project is a terrific way to explore all of those relationships, using the BlackBerry Z10 and the BlackBerry Keep Moving Hub to find out how technology and community interaction can inspire the artistic process, and elevate the work itself to another level.” (more…)
Order of Dane Maddock Books
Dane Maddock is the central character in a series of action-thriller/adventure novels by American novelist David Wood. In the series, Maddock teams with Uriah “Bones” Bonebrake to hunt for treasure and what they usually end up finding is trouble. They explore sunken ships, lost treasures and ancient mysteries. Flavia De Luce To Get British TV Adaptation
Written by Ella Thomson on Monday, February 11th, 2013With the fifth novel of the Flavia de Luce series coming out, the 11 year-old detective is also going to be making her way to television.
“It’s incredible, it’s almost unbelievable,” says author Alan Bradley regarding the fact that Sam Mendes (Skyfall, American Beauty) will be at the helm of the proposed series. (more…)
Stephen King Discusses “Doctor Sleep”
Written by Ella Thomson on Monday, February 11th, 2013Stephen King recently spoke to Entertainment Weekly about his upcoming novel, Doctor Sleep. It is, of course, the sequel to his classic novel The Shining.
“When the [sequel] idea would pop up in my mind I would think, ‘Now Danny’s 20, or now he’s 25. … I wonder if he’s drinking like his father?’” he said. “Finally I decided ‘Okay, why don’t I use that in the story and just revisit that whole issue? Like father, like son.’” (more…)
Order of David Wood Books
David Wood is an American author of action-thriller, adventure, fantasy and speculative fiction novels. He writes the Dane Maddock Adventures series as well as The Absent Gods fantasy series (as David Debord). He enjoys history, archaeology, mythology and cryptozoology. His favourite books include Pendergast by Preston & Child, the Dirk Pitt books, anything by James Rollins and Robert Jordan‘s The Wheel of Time. (more…)
Order of Ember Books
The Books of Ember is a young adult fantasy quartet by American novelist Jeanne DuPrau. The Books of Ember are about a city where there’s no light – no sun, no moon, no natural light at all. The only source of light is electricity, which is beginning to fail. The series is being adapted to graphic novel format. (more…)
Order of Jeanne DuPrau Books
Jeanne DuPrau is an American author of fantasy and young adult novels. She is the author of the Books of Ember fantasy series. Jeanne never set out to become a writer, but has always enjoyed writing. She wrote her first book when she was five titled Frosty the Snowman, which is five pages long and illustrated in crayon. In her spare time, Jeanne enjoys ice skating, bird watching, gardening, playing piano and cooking. (more…)
Order of Haunted Bookshop Mysteries Books
The Haunted Bookshop Mysteries is a cozy mystery series by Alice Kimberly (Alice Alfonsi & Marc Cerasini). The series follows Penelope Thornton-McClure, who owns a bookshop in Rhode Island that is haunted by the ghost of Jack Shepard, who assists her in solving various mysteries. (more…)
Order of Coffeehouse Mysteries Books
The Coffehouse Mysteries is a series of cozy mystery novels by Cleo Coyle, the pen name of American authors Alice Alfonsi and Marc Cerasini. The series is set in a Greenwich Village coffeehouse called the Village Blend, which is managed by Clare Cosi. The Village Blend is considered to be a local landmark of sorts. (more…)
Order of Marc Cerasini Books
Marc Cerasini is an American author of cozy mystery novels, young adult novels, picture books, television tie-ins, movie novelizations and military non-fiction. He co-authors the Coffeehouse Mysteries and Haunted Bookshop Mysteries with his wife, Alice Alfonsi. He has also ghostwritten for Tom Clancy. He is a New York Times and USA Today bestselling author.
